In the USA, I'm not surprised that both roads and rail are "showing the same" with this tool, as our TIGER import (circa 2006-7) included both.  There were and are many problems with these data.  I have spent significant time doing TIGER Review of both road and especially rail data and it is a great deal of work, with slow (but steady) progress.

Though, TIGER Review and correction of these data's many sorts of problems has been an ongoing effort by many in OSM; I've seen estimates that it will take until the 2040s before this Review is completed (and all of the noise eventually resolved).  Unfortunately, many of the excellent tools that allowed for comprehensive review of the data have sadly passed away, even as significant TIGER Review remains necessary in a great many areas of the USA.  (My favorite was the ITO map tool, discontinued in mid-2019).  Our wiki [1] offers several current strategies to fix these data.

Based on my initial though cursory review of the TomTom tool, it will only help this effort — really, multiple efforts to data garden and improve map data quality.  I agree the tool "shows a lot of promise."  Please, Steve, keep up the good work.
